
T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The prosecutor denies the rumors that former Deputy Attorney General for Special Crimes (Jampidsus) Febrie Adriansyah fled to Saudi Arabia to perform the Umrah pilgrimage. "It's not true, how could he go for Umrah? He has been barred. No, he didn't flee," said the Head of the Legal Information Center of the Attorney General's Office, Anang Supriatna, to the media at the Attorney General's Office building, South Jakarta, on Monday, July 13, 2026.
He explained that Febrie Adriansyah had been prohibited by Immigration. Therefore, he cannot leave Indonesia. "We can confirm that he is in Indonesia, not abroad, and has been barred. It's also under the investigator's surveillance," said Anang.
Rumors about Febrie Adriansyah going for Umrah circulated on social media. One of them was through a post from the account X @Sentjoko. "Indonesia has just lost a religious anti-corruption law enforcer: Febrie Adriansyah, the pious Jampidsus, the strongest candidate for the Attorney General. After his residence was searched and 74 kg of gold were confiscated, he resigned in the early hours of July 11th and immediately went for Umrah to meet @Allah estewe," wrote the account in Indonesian on Saturday, July 11, 2026.
The account posted a photo of Febrie Adriansyah wearing a white koko shirt and a white cap in front of the Ka'bah. The post was captioned with several Indonesian narratives: "CLOSEST SOURCE INDICATES: After announcing his resignation, Jampidsus immediately flew to Saudi Arabia to perform Umrah," one of the narratives stated.
